The New England Patriots are on the verge of potentially claiming their seventh Super Bowl title at the conclusion of the 2025-26 NFL season. They will face off against the Seattle Seahawks in Super Bowl LX, hoping to extend their record of Super Bowl victories from six to seven.

The Patriots have firmly established themselves as a powerhouse in the NFL, with all six of their championship wins occurring between 2002 and 2019. They hold the record for the most Super Bowl appearances, totaling eleven. Their victories came against formidable opponents, including the St. Louis Rams, Carolina Panthers, Philadelphia Eagles, Seattle Seahawks, Atlanta Falcons, and Los Angeles Rams. One of their most iconic moments came when they orchestrated a remarkable comeback against the Falcons, overcoming a 25-point deficit to win in overtime, a feat regarded as the greatest comeback in Super Bowl history.

This era of dominance can largely be attributed to the legendary duo of Tom Brady and Bill Belichick. Brady, a sixth-round draft pick in 2000, has set numerous records, including most Super Bowl victories and career passing yards. Belichick is celebrated for his coaching prowess, holding the record for the most playoff wins by any head coach.

Following the Patriots, the Pittsburgh Steelers also share the record for the most Super Bowl wins, with six championships under their belt. Their titles span different decades, showcasing their ability to succeed across various eras of the league. The San Francisco 49ers follow with five victories, while the Dallas Cowboys also have five Super Bowl wins to their name.

The Green Bay Packers and New York Giants each have four championships, with the Packers recognized for their historic dominance in the early years of the NFL. The current dynasty, the Kansas City Chiefs, have secured four Super Bowl titles, with three coming in the last five seasons under the leadership of stars like Patrick Mahomes.
